The evolution of Still Bay points at Sibudu
Archaeological and Anthropological Sciences ( IF 2.2 ) Pub Date : 2021-06-25 , DOI: 10.1007/s12520-021-01359-4
Amy Mosig Way , Peter Hiscock

The Still Bay is a key technocomplex within the Middle Stone Age (MSA), and Sibudu, in Kwa-Zulu Natal, South Africa, provides one of the longest and richest pre-Still Bay to Still Bay sequences. It has been hypothesised that the Still Bay industry emerged through technological revolution or alternatively through gradual change. In this paper we conduct a geometric morphometric (GM) assessment of the shape differences between the pre-Still Bay and Still Bay points at Sibudu to assess their implication for technological evolution. Pre-Still Bay points are often thought of as unifacial and single-pointed, and Still Bay points as bifacial and double-pointed. Our analysis reveals a more complex and evolving pattern, lending support for the gradual change hypothesis. When the earliest pre-Still Bay points are compared with the Still Bay points, a significant difference in shape is seen. However, intermediate units provide evidence of an evolutionary continuum between those distinct ends of the continuum.
